yep your right, didn't spot the T in the op! i've got a 720t, i've only used the T part a few times (just a receiver you plug in) and imho your better listening to the radio traffic reports. i was 2 hours off the heathrow side of the 25, tt said 4 hour delay do you want to re-route. the radio said a small shunt, so i figure chances are it'll be all clear by the time i get there, which it was. i wouldn't bother with it at the mo and if if does improve you can always buy the receiver at a later date.
